Marek Továrek has been competing for 11 years. His best event is the 3×3: a personal-best single of 11.36, set at Czech Open 2017, puts him in the top 11.6% of the 284,439 people who have ever been ranked in the event, and 180th in the Czech Republic. Across 7 competitions since July 2015, he has put 196 official solves on the record across eight events. Solve to solve, his 3×3 times vary about 13% around a typical one, steadier than 55% of the 35,811 competitors with ten or more counted rounds. His 3×3 best has come down from 15.54 in July 2015 to 11.36, a 27% improvement. Marek has entered seven competitions, more competitions than 88% of everyone who has ever competed.

Reading this page: a single is one solve's time · an average is the middle three of five solves, best and worst discarded · a PB is a personal best · a DNF (did not finish) is an attempt with no valid result: a popped piece, an unsolved face, an over-limit memorisation · top X% compares against everyone ever ranked in that event, which is fairer than raw rank because event pools differ tenfold.
